BATON ROUGE - Police arrested a man after responding to a shooting near Mission Drive Saturday afternoon.According to the Baton Rouge Police Department, officers responded to a shooting at the 3100 block of Mission Drive around 1:15 p.m. While on scene, officers learned of a subject seen entering a nearby apartment with a rifle. Officers made contact with the person and searched the apartment.Police arrested Kristopher Hills, 29, after locating a Bear Creek Arsenal .223 AR pistol that was...
